What Kind of Rules and Regulations Are There in the Industry?
The law states explicitly that only dentists may practice dentistry, not corporations. However, there is no requirement that doctors directly own dental clinics in most states, meaning that a franchisee can own a FLOSS Dental™ and employ dentists to practice dentistry. FLOSS Dental offices are bound by the same rules as any other business practicing dentistry—business license, dental license, necessary equipment registration, etc.
